Gabriele Canna, PhD, is currently an assistant professor at LCC International University in Klaipeda, Lithuania, where he teaches the undergraduate courses of Calculus, College Algebra, Statistics and Quantitative Reasoning.
Gabriele holds a PhD in Mathematical Finance from University of Milano-Bicocca (Italy), a master’s degree in finance and a bachelor’s degree in Business Administration both from University of Piemonte Orientale (Italy).
Gabriele has conducted research on capital allocation problems and risk measure theory, during his PhD program and afterwards. He has published his works in international journals and presented them in several international workshops and conferences.
